买专利,只认龙图腾
首页 专利交易 科技果 科技人才 科技服务 商标交易 会员权益 IP管家助手 需求市场 关于龙图腾
 /  免费注册
到顶部 到底部
清空 搜索

【发明授权】一种具有服务质量保证的802.11ax密集WiFi网络AP布置方法_韩山师范学院_202011095386.0 

申请/专利权人:韩山师范学院

申请日:2020-10-14

公开(公告)日:2023-04-11

公开(公告)号:CN112312408B

主分类号:H04W16/18

分类号:H04W16/18;H04W24/06;H04W24/02;H04W52/02;H04W28/18

优先权:

专利状态码:有效-授权

法律状态:2023.04.11#授权;2021.02.23#实质审查的生效;2021.02.02#公开

摘要:一种具有服务质量保证的802.11ax密集WiFi网络AP布置方法,包括以下步骤:1、问题描述,过程如下:1.1建立网络模型;1.2建立干扰模型;2ProcedureI获得STA的吞吐量的步骤如下:2.1STA‑AP关联;2.2AP功率调整;2.3AP信道分配和功率再调整;2.4STARU分配;2.5获取STA的数据速率;2.6计算STA的吞吐量;3设计四阶段启发式算法Algorithm_4stages求解优化问题。本发明融合了AP布置和功率‑信道‑RU分配,在满足失效容忍和用户个性化吞吐量需求的前提下减少AP数量,节约802.11ax密集WiFi网络的部署成本。

主权项:1.一种具有服务质量保证的802.11ax密集WiFi网络AP布置方法,其特征在于,所述方法包括以下步骤:1.1建立网络模型网络服务的目标区域包含VIP区域和普通区域两个子区域,分别以Vvip和V表示,且以AP表示网络接入点,以STA表示网络站点,以Ω表示AP候选位置集合,该集合是事先已知的,即目标区域Vvip∪V被划分为|Ω|个网格,AP只能布置在网格的中心,在每个网格之内,可以根据STA的密度布置0个、1个或多个AP;网络由如下三种设备组成:网络控制器、AP和STA;网络控制器负责网络的管理和协调,在网络控制器的协调之下,AP在传输数据之前不需要退避;以S和A分别表示STA和AP集合,任意STAi∈S只能与一个APj∈A关联,当一个AP集合Af满足|Af||A|失效时,与故障AP关联的STA可以与其他正常的AP重新关联以获取网络服务,网络采用2.4和5GHz两个频段,在这两个频段中,每个信道的带宽为bMHz,b∈B={20,40,80,160}MHz,网络采用OFDMA物理层,在OFDMA中,每个STA在传输数据时不占用整个信道,而是由AP向其分配合适的RU以支持多STA并行传输,每个AP只能分配一个信道,所分配的信道属于一个给定的信道集合C,每个STA只能分配一个j-toneRU,j∈K={26,52,106,242,484,996,2×996},其中,K是每个RU中所包含的子载波数目的集合,以P表示AP的功率值集合,每个AP可分配属于P的一个功率值,每个STA所采用的功率与其AP相同;在OFDMA机制之下,TXOP、SIFS、M-BA和OFDMA-BA分别表示传输机会、短帧间间隔、多STA块确认和OFDMA块确认;在OFDMA帧交换过程中,STA仅在接收到触发帧TF之后才开始将上行PPDU传输给其AP,STA在接收到下行PPDU之后,将OFDMA-BA帧回复给其AP;1.2建立干扰模型以li,j表示节点i和j之间的链路,节点指的是AP或STA;要使节点i通过链路li,j从j正确接收到帧,则节点i从j处的接收信号强度RSS必须不低于帧解码阈值θD,在这种情况下,节点i在j的通信范围内,如果节点i和j位于信道相互重叠的不同链路上且i从j接收到的信号强度大于或等于干扰信号强度阈值θI,则节点i会被j干扰;在这种情况下,节点i在j的干扰范围之内,θDθI,为了获得AP的通信范围和干扰范围,定义以下路径损耗模型:RSS=Pj+GTX-Plost+GRX1其中,Plost=Pref+10lgdη+χ2在式1和2中,RSS是接收方的接收信号强度,d是发送方和接收方之间的距离,Pj是发送方j的发射功率,GTX和GRX是发送方和接收方的天线增益,Pref是参照距离处的路径损耗,η是路径损耗指数,χ是与阴影衰落程度相关的标准差;因此,得到: 以rj和γj分别表示节点j的通信范围和干扰范围,则: 由式1至4以及θD和θI的值,可以获得节点的通信范围和干扰范围;建立网络干扰模型,以li,x和lj,y分别表示APi和STAx以及APj和STAy之间的链路,以di,x和dj,y分别表示APi和STAx以及APj和STAy之间的距离,以γx和γy分别表示STAx和STAy的干扰范围;以Si和Sj分别表示与APi和j相关联的STA集合,定义APi和j之间的干扰距离为: 如果APi和j之间的距离小于或等于Ii,j且它们的信道彼此重叠,i≠j,则链路li,x和lj,y相互干扰,即链路li,x和lj,y不能同时传输;1.3优化问题以δi表示STAi的吞吐量,表述为以下优化问题: 在约束条件C1中,如果STAi与APj关联,则指示变量ai,j=1,否则ai,j=0,C1表示当|Af|=n个AP同时失效时,任何STAi∈S都可以与APj关联以获得WiFi服务,j∈A\Af;在约束条件C2和C3中,STAi既表示第i个STA,也表示该STA位于第i个位置;C2表示当STAi位于VIP区域时,其吞吐量大于或等于ρH;C3表示当STAi位于VIP区域之外时,其吞吐量大于或等于ρL,其中,ρHρL;将C1称为失效容忍需求,将C2和C3称为用户个性化吞吐量需求;2STA的吞吐量的计算,采用ProcedureI获得STA的吞吐量;ProcedureI获得STA的吞吐量的步骤如下:2.1.STA-AP关联;2.2.AP功率调整;2.3.AP信道分配和功率再调整;2.4.STARU分配;2.5.获取STA的数据速率;2.6.计算STA的吞吐量;3启发式算法A表示AP集合,A也可以表示具体的AP布置方案,由四个阶段组成,每个阶段的关键操作是测试当前的AP布置方案A是否可行,设计算法Algorithm_test进行可行性测试;Algorithm_test:可行性测试,输入:A,S,Ω,P,C,n;输出:指示变量I,I=TRUE表示A可行,I=FALSE表示A不可行,测试过程如下:3.1.1将I置为TRUE;3.1.2判断优化问题6的约束条件C1是否能满足,若是,则转向3.1.3;若否,则置I为FALSE并转向3.1.4;3.1.3在A中删除n=|Af|个AP,表示有n个AP失效,再调用ProcedureI以获得STA的吞吐量,然后,判断优化问题6的约束条件C2和C3是否能满足,若在种AP失效情形下方案A都能满足C2和C3,则转向3.1.4;若种AP失效情形中有任意一种情形不能满足C2和C3,则置I为FALSE并转向3.1.4;3.1.4返回I的值设计四阶段启发式算法Algorithm_4stages求解优化问题6,过程如下:第一阶段:采用贪婪法生成初始AP布置方案A1;第二阶段:移除A1中多余的AP;第三阶段:迭代地将两个距离最近的AP替换为一个;第四阶段:迭代地将三个邻近的AP替换为两个;在第三和第四阶段中,计算每对AP或每组AP的STA覆盖密度CD,先给出CD的定义:定义1:每对AP的覆盖密度CDpairCDpair=两个AP所覆盖的STA总数量与这两个AP的距离的比值定义2:每组AP的覆盖密度CDgroupCDgroup=三个AP所覆盖的STA总数量与这三个AP的坐标所组成的三角形的周长的比值;第一阶段:采用贪婪法生成初始AP布置方案A1,步骤如下:3.2.1放置一个AP到未被覆盖的STA密度最大的区域,并将被该AP所覆盖的STA标记为已覆盖;3.2.2调用算法Algorithm_test测试当前方案是否可行,若是,则转向3.2.3;若否,则转向3.2.1;3.2.3返回初始布置方案A1;第二阶段:移除A1中多余的AP,步骤如下:3.3.1按每个AP所关联的STA的数量进行升序排序,生成AP队列Qb;3.3.2按Qb中AP的顺序,逐个尝试删除,每删除一个AP之后,就调用算法Algorithm_test对当前方案进行可行性测试,若可行,则返回3.3.1;若不可行,则将所删除的AP还原并继续尝试删除队列Qb中下一个AP,直至总共|Qb|次删除尝试完成为止;3.3.3返回A2;第三阶段:将两个距离最近的AP替换为一个,步骤如下:3.4.1生成对AP;3.4.2计算每对AP的STA覆盖密度CDpair;3.4.3按CDpair的值升序排序以生成替换队列Qc[i]={APi1,APi2},其中APi1和APi2表示队列Qc中第i对AP中的两个AP,3.4.4按Qc中AP对的顺序,逐对尝试替换为一个新AP,新AP的位置可在候选位置集Ω中搜索获得,然后,调用算法Algorithm_test对当前方案进行可行性测试,若可行,则返回3.4.1,此时A2中的AP数量减少1个;若不可行,则将所替换的AP对还原,继续尝试替换Qc中下一对AP,如此反复,直至总共|Qc|次替换尝试完成为止;3.4.5返回A3;第四阶段:将三个邻近的AP替换为两个,过程如下:3.5.1生成组AP;3.5.2计算每组AP的STA覆盖密度CDgroup;3.5.3按CDgroup的值升序排序以生成替换队列Qd[i]={APi1,APi2,APi3},其中APi1、APi2和APi3表示队列Qd中第i组AP中的三个AP,3.5.4按Qd中AP组的顺序,逐组尝试替换为两个新AP,两个新AP的位置可在候选位置集Ω中搜索获得,然后,调用算法Algorithm_test对当前方案进行可行性测试,若可行,则返回3.5.1,此时A3中的AP数量减少1个;若不可行,则将所替换的AP组还原,继续尝试替换Qd中的下一对组AP,如此反复,直至总共|Qd|次替换尝试完成为止;3.5.5返回A4。

全文数据:

权利要求:

百度查询: 韩山师范学院 一种具有服务质量保证的802.11ax密集WiFi网络AP布置方法

免责声明
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。